Java games with 640x360 resolution represent the pinnacle of J2ME technology, bridging the gap between retro mobile gaming and the smartphone era.
The UnsungHD Era: Java J2ME Games (640x360 Resolution) Platform: Nokia Symbian (S60v5), Sony Ericsson (A200), Samsung Era: 2008 – 2012
